Hi all,

I'm new to Resolume. I have something specific in mind (see attachment) and I need the 'Divide' mode as featured in After Effects and Photoshop. I'm hoping someone somewhere has made this patch!?

In the attached example, I used Divide to blend the geometry into the stars. The geometry interacts with the changing brightness values in the stars. If anyone knows how to replicate this in Resolume your help would be much appreciated!

This blend mode simply divides pixel values of one layer with the other.

Are you working with a Mac or PC, i have a fisrt version to test with. It seems that a Divide is a dodge with inverted top layer. So i made the plugin and it seems to work but i'm not sure though if it works as it should.
